DIY ceiling roses with a contemporary geometric twist

These are ceiling roses with a serious twist! Contemporary and personalised, the Rhombus Ceiling Tiles give you the opportunity to flex your creative muscles.

Arriving as 72 individual geometric tiles, they can be applied to suit your style or according to the pattern suggestions supplied.

With enough tiles to cover two square metres, you simply stick them to the ceiling and paint them the colour of your choice (I’m particularly liking the use of contrasting colours). And if you don’t fancy a ceiling rose, how about a quirky piece of wall art, with the tiles able to stick to any surface (within reason, of course!)?
